Career blocked shots: Mark Giordano, 2,164
Mark Giordano is the NHL’s all-time blocked shots leader with 2,164. The 40-year-old defenseman played 46 games for the Toronto Maple Leafs last season, but he did not sign with anyone in the offseason, potentially leaving his record up for grabs. Marc-Édouard Vlasic enters the season only 20 blocked shots behind Giordano and he has recorded over 100 in each of the past two seasons.
